services

[ UK /sˈɜːvɪsɪz/ ]
[ US /ˈsɝvəsəz, ˈsɝvɪsɪz/ ]
NOUN
  1. performance of duties or provision of space and equipment helpful to others
    the mayor tried to maintain city services
    the medical services are excellent
